Hi all,

Knowing nothing about diamonds a few months ago, I have spent extensive time on this site and find it to be a fantastic reference and knowledge base. I have finally found a diamond, that on paper, meets my criteria and I will be taking a look at it later this week. The only thing that has me raising an eye on the cert. are the measurements: 6.81x6.89 This difference is larger than what I have generally seen. Should this be a concern? For reference the rest of the diamond stats are:

1.21
VS2
table 57%
depth 61.3%
crown 35%
pavilion 40.8%

Hi Teryx,

The diameter variance is fine actually, nothing to be concerned about. The variance is a little more than many of the super tight diameters we often see on diamonds which are cut to the very strictest standards, but still within acceptable range. I would be more concerned about getting an Idealscope image to see how well these crown and pavilion angles work together, can you get one from the vendor?

What are the polish and symmetry grades and girdle thickness please? I take it the diamond is GIA graded also?
